Avoid eating grapefruit before taking medicine Since grapefruit itself contains an active substance that can inhibit a certain enzyme in the human intestine, if grapefruit is consumed while taking medication, it will not only affect the normal metabolism of the drug and cause the drug to lose its efficacy, but will also increase blood concentration, thereby affecting the liver's detoxification function and causing liver damage. It may also cause other adverse reactions and even poisoning. For example, if grapefruit is consumed while taking anti-allergic drugs, the patient may suffer from dizziness, palpitations, and arrhythmias, or even sudden death. Clinical observations have found that patients with hyperlipidemia can take a tablet of lovastatin (also known as melipridone) with a cup of grapefruit juice. The result is equivalent to the lipid-lowering effect of taking 12 to 15 tablets of lovastatin with a cup of water. As a result, patients will experience muscle pain and even kidney disease. Some patients, while taking the anti-allergic drug terfenadine, if they eat grapefruit or drink grapefruit juice, may experience dizziness, palpitations, arrhythmia, etc. at the mildest, or even sudden death at the worst. |
